Diet and the Gut Microbiome

The food we eat plays an essential role in maintaining the diversity and proper functioning of our gut microbiota. Prebiotics and probiotics are two of the most widely studied elements in the field of gut microbiota. Both have effects that are considered beneficial for the gut microbiota which impacts various functions of the body such as the digestive condition, for this reason, specialists highlight the importance of including both of them in our diet, in order to promote a healthy microbiota.
